Ange Postecoglou has named his Tottenham Hotspur side which will take to the field in this evening’s Premier League clash against Brighton and Hove Albion at the Amex Stadium.

Tottenham are looking to finish 2023 on a high as they look to secure their fourth Premier League victory in a row following the recent wins over Newcastle United, Nottingham Forest and Everton with just Bournemouth left to play in N17 following this fixture.

Ange Postecoglou was dealt a blow with the news of Cristian Romero‘s hamstring injury which he sustained in the 2-1 win against the Toffees and had to be withdrawn at half time, with the Australian admitting at yesterday’s pre-match press conference that he is expecting the World Cup winner to be out of action for four to five weeks.

Spurs team news vs Brighton

Postecoglou told Football.London: “It’s not so great with Romero. He had a scan the other day. He’s got a hamstring strain. So we’re looking at probably four weeks, five weeks for him. Everyone else from the last game …. yeah, it was pretty demanding physically in terms of the numbers we generated that day. Both us and Everton. It was quite extraordinary.

“So fair to say the boys were a bit fatigued but had a couple of easier days so everyone else should be OK.”

Brighton are having a tough time currently and have only won two of their past 12 league matches, averaging a point per game.

This is who takes to the field under the lights on the south coast this evening:

Brighton — Steele; Hinshelwood, van Hecke, Dunk(C), Igor Julio; Gilmour, Milner; Buonanotte, Groß, Welbeck; João Pedro.

Subs: Ferguson, Moder, Verbruggen, Dahoud, Lallana, Barrington, Baleba, Estupiñán, Baker-Boaitey

Tottenham Hotspur — Vicario; Porro, Udogie, Davies, Emerson Royal; Sarr, Højbjerg; Johnson, Kulusevski, Son(C); Richarlison.

Subs: Forster, Dier, Dorrington, Phillips, Lo Celso, Santiago, Donley, Bryan, Veliz.
